**POST WEDDING REVIEW**
Overall, the experience with Ever After Farms was really good. The venue is truly beautiful and well kept and it’s a reasonable price if you plan on taking advantage of and using some of the many decor options they have....
There’s a few things to know about the venue:
1. The bridal suite really isn’t very big for an entire bridal party to get ready in. If you have a large wedding party, plan on getting ready somewhere else if you’re on a strict timeline because space is limited.
2. You only get the venue for 10 hours on the day of the wedding. If you plan on utilizing the bridal suite to get ready, plan on paying extra for an additional 2 hours. BUT tours will still be happening during those hours. On my wedding day, it was quite windy and tours coming in and out of the venue were accidentally blowing table settings around indoors. ALSO, this isn’t a huge deal for a summer wedding, but in the fall the 10 hours (access at noon) means you have less than 4 hours to set up and get ready before a ceremony before sunset happens. Not including before photos.
3. They do not include a Day of Coordinator. If you were planning on not having one, it’s a necessity (and yes my wedding was on a tight budget). It’s not a big deal that it’s not included, but it’s just something to note so that you know to factor that in!
4. The venue is in a REALLY small town! It creates a great country atmosphere. If you aren’t picky about hotels, there’s a couple within 15 minutes, but if you want to stay somewhere really nice as a wedding night treat, plan on driving 30-45 minutes to New Smyrna or Cocoa Beach.
5. Your rehearsal will be on a Thursday because they have weddings Fri-Sun. Our rehearsal time got double booked on accident somehow.
6. I really really wish they had a TRUE list of items at the venue you can use. They have most of the table decor listed, but a lot of little things (the window frame used for table assignments, the welcome to our wedding sign, unplugged ceremony sign, etc) were left out online prior to my wedding. I wasn’t sure what all I needed until our walk-through a month in advance.
7. The staff is SUPER NICE and they are typically very fast at responding to emails and texts with questions!
8. The bathrooms and basically the whole venue is handicap accessible, this is especially important for elderly family members!
9. Many venues with an outdoor ceremony site under a tree have the ceremony quite a walk from the actual reception area (rough on elderly family). Here, it is RIGHT next to it, literally 10 steps away. It’s fantastic.
10. Not having a requirement as to who to use for catering made things very easy for us and we were able to choose an affordable option that was also the talk of the town (thanks Mission BBQ).
11. They are ALWAYS adding new things! When I booked, the brick path, frosted greenery, and string lights outside weren’t there! It was so exciting seeing all the additions they kept doing that made the venue better and better.
12. The photo booth is SO worth it! Our guest book is filled with images of loved ones literally having the time of their lives, and they got more and more drunk as the night went on. The photos are hilarious.
OVERALL, the venue is absolutely gorgeous. On a small &tight budget it can be pricey, BUT buying decor really isn’t needed so that is a huge savings! The staff is kind and helpful, especially on the day of. I would book them all over again if I could do it over!
